About the Role
Quality Plumbing is looking for a motivated Apprentice Plumber to join our residential plumbing team in the Seattle area. This is a great opportunity for someone who wants to build a long-term career in the plumbing trade, learn from experienced plumbers, and be part of a company known for craftsmanship, integrity, and exceptional employee retention.
In this role, you'll work alongside licensed plumbers on high-end residential remodels, service calls, and smaller plumbing projects. You'll gain hands-on experience with water, waste, vent, gas piping, fixtures, tools, job site preparation, and the standards that have helped Quality Plumbing serve the Seattle area since 1978.
This position is ideal for someone who is reliable, hardworking, eager to learn, and serious about becoming a skilled plumber.

About Quality Plumbing
Founded in 1978, Quality Plumbing is a well-established plumbing company known for high-end remodels, quality residential plumbing, and exceptional craftsmanship in the Seattle area. While we're proud to be family-owned, our roots run deeper than one family. Our team includes multiple generations from five different families, many of whom have been with us for decades.
Nearly every plumber started here as an apprentice, and with about 23 employees, we take pride in the strong community we've built, one where dedication, skill, and integrity are what matter most.
